Manchester United to offer Anthony Martial in exchange for Chelsea midfielder Willian

Manchester United will launch a last-ditch bid to land Jose Mourinho’s top target Willian.

Mourinho is set on beating Barcelona to the punch for the Brazilian attacker before the transfer window shuts on Thursday.

Mourinho has lost patience with French striker Anthony Martial and will offer him in return for Willian.

Both are valued at £75million – and both want to leave their clubs for a fresh challenge.

Willian, 29, has been on Mourinho’s radar ever since the Portuguese took charge at United, and the Brazilian’s recent problems at Chelsea have encouraged his former Stamford Bridge boss that a deal can be done.

The South American has already irritated new Blues boss Maurizio Sarri by arriving back late from his summer break, citing an expired passport as the reason.

And Willian has added to growing disquiet by publicly stating that an agent claiming to have a mandate to negotiate his transfer, doesn’t have authority to act for him.

Sarri insists he wants to keep Willian but Mourinho isn’t giving up – viewing his pace, goal threat and winning mentality as attributes his squad is short on.

United’s board are reluctant to give up on Martial, but Mourinho doesn’t have confidence in the youngster and would happily trade him.

After seeing Nemanja Matic join United a year ago, Chelsea aren’t keen to let another big name go to Old Trafford.

That’s not stopping Mourinho or Woodward trying to do a deal, with a move for Inter’s Croatian winger Ivan Perisic put on the back burner.

Leicester defender Harry Maguire is also on Mourinho’s wish-list.

So is Barcelona’s giant Colombian centre back Yerry Mina.

But Mourinho would have to ditch one from Chris Smalling, Marcos Rojo or Phil Jones to help finance either of those defensive deals.
